org.jboss.ejb3.common.resolvers.spi
Interface EjbReferenceResolver

All Known Implementing Classes:
FirstMatchEjbReferenceResolver

public interface EjbReferenceResolver

EjbReferenceResolver


Method Summary
 java.lang.String resolveEjb(org.jboss.deployers.structure.spi.DeploymentUnit du, EjbReference reference)
          Returns the JNDI Name of the proxy described by the specified arguments.
 

Method Detail

resolveEjb

java.lang.String resolveEjb(org.jboss.deployers.structure.spi.DeploymentUnit du,
                            EjbReference reference)
                            throws UnresolvableReferenceException
Returns the JNDI Name of the proxy described by the specified arguments.

Parameters:
du - The DeploymentUnit in question
reference - The EJB reference used
Returns:
Throws:
UnresolvableReferenceException - If the reference cannot be resolved within scope